Purchasing Power Analysis
A Industrial Engineers in Alameda, CA earns $83,704 in nominal terms, which is 4.6% above the national average of $80,000. After adjusting for the local cost of living (index 138.5 vs national 100), this is equivalent to $60,436 in national-average purchasing power.
Tax differences are not included. Only cost-of-living index adjustments are applied.
